War-torn Irun; Spanish Civil War, 1936
Photograph showing the burnt-out city of Irun in northern Spain, during the early stages of the Spanish Civil War, 1936. Irun was captured by Nationalist forces on 5th September that year. It was reported that much of the damage visible in this photograph was caused by Republican forces, just before they retreated from the city. Date: 1936
